Explore topic-wise MCQs in Computer Science Engineering (CSE).

This section includes 1167 Mcqs, each offering curated multiple-choice questions to sharpen your Computer Science Engineering (CSE) knowledge and support exam preparation. Choose a topic below to get started.

1151.

Agile Software Development is based on

A. incremental development
B. iterative development
C. linear development
D. both incremental and iterative development
Answer» E.
1152.

Which model can be selected if user is involved in all the phases of SDLC?

A. waterfall model
B. prototyping model
C. rad model
D. both prototyping model & rad model
Answer» D. both prototyping model & rad model
1153.

SDLC stands for

A. software development life cycle
B. system development life cycle
C. software design life cycle
D. system design life cycle
Answer» B. system development life cycle
1154.

What is the major drawback of using RAD Model?

A. highly specialized & skilled developers/designers are required
B. increases reusability of components
C. encourages customer/client feedback
D. increases reusability of components, highly specialized & skilled developers/designers are required
Answer» E.
1155.

RAD Model has

A. 2 phases
B. 3 phase
C. 5 phases
D. 6 phases
Answer» D. 6 phases
1156.

Which of the following statements regarding Build & Fix Model is wrong?

A. no room for structured design
B. code soon becomes unfixable & unchangeable
C. maintenance is practically not possible
D. it scales up well to large projects
Answer» E.
1157.

Which one of the following is not a phase of Prototyping Model?

A. quick design
B. coding
C. prototype refinement
D. engineer product
Answer» C. prototype refinement
1158.

Which is not one of the types of prototype of Prototyping Model?

A. horizontal prototype
B. vertical prototype
C. diagonal prototype
D. domain prototype
Answer» D. domain prototype
1159.

Which one of the following models is not suitable for accommodating any change?

A. build & fix model
B. prototyping model
C. rad model
D. waterfall model
Answer» E.
1160.

RAD stands for

A. relative application development
B. rapid application development
C. rapid application document
D. none of the mentioned
Answer» C. rapid application document
1161.

Build & Fix Model is suitable for programming exercises of                        LOC (Line of Code).

A. 100-200
B. 200-400
C. 400-1000
D. above 1000
Answer» B. 200-400
1162.

Company has latest computers and state- of the- art software tools, so we shouldn’t worry about the quality of the product.

A. true
B. false
Answer» C.
1163.

The reason for software bugs and failures is due to

A. software companies
B. software developers
C. both software companies and developers
D. all of the mentioned
Answer» D. all of the mentioned
1164.

Efficiency in a software product does not include

A. responsiveness
B. licensing
C. memory utilization
D. processing time
Answer» C. memory utilization
1165.

Select the incorrect statement: “Software engineers should

A. not knowingly accept work that is outside your competence.”
B. not use your technical skills to misuse other people’s computers.”
C. be dependent on their colleagues.”
D. maintain integrity and independence in their professional judgment.”
Answer» D. maintain integrity and independence in their professional judgment.”
1166.

“Software engineers should not use their technical skills to misuse other people’s computers.”Here the term misuse refers to:

A. unauthorized access to computer material
B. unauthorized modification of computer material
C. dissemination of viruses or other malware
D. all of the mentioned
Answer» E.
1167.

Choose the correct option in terms of Issues related to professional responsibility

A. confidentiality
B. intellectual property rights
C. both confidentiality & intellectual property rights
D. managing client relationships
Answer» D. managing client relationships